For multi-homed devices it would be interesting being able to specify a preferred source address for routes exported via babel. If the preferred src address is not specified, the kernel will select the src address and thus will leak ipv6 addresses into a network where they are foreign.

This should be configurable and could be static for one babeld instance.
Before going ahead and patching this into kernel_netlink.c (around line 1053 I think) I would like to get some feedback on the idea.
